Lines Matching refs:test_data
72 uint8_t test_data[kTestMemorySize];
83 size_t size = read_inferior_memory(inferior, test_data_addr, test_data, sizeof(test_data));
84 EXPECT_EQ(size, sizeof(test_data), "read_inferior_memory: short read");
86 for (unsigned i = 0; i < sizeof(test_data); ++i) {
87 EXPECT_EQ(test_data[i], i, "test_memory_ops");
90 for (unsigned i = 0; i < sizeof(test_data); ++i) {
91 test_data[i] = static_cast<uint8_t>(test_data[i] + kTestDataAdjust);
94 size = write_inferior_memory(inferior, test_data_addr, test_data, sizeof(test_data));
95 EXPECT_EQ(size, sizeof(test_data), "write_inferior_memory: short write");
1050 uint8_t test_data[kTestMemorySize];
1051 for (unsigned i = 0; i < sizeof(test_data); ++i)
1052 test_data[i] = static_cast<uint8_t>(i);
1060 // Set r9 to point to test_data so we can easily access it
1065 movq %[test_data],%%r9\n\
1071 : [zero] "g"(0), [test_data] "g"(&test_data[0]), [pc] "g"(segv_pc)
1083 // Set r9 to point to test_data so we can easily access it
1088 mov x9,%[test_data]\n\
1094 : [test_data] "r"(&test_data[0]), [pc] "r"(segv_pc)
1098 // On resumption test_data should have had kTestDataAdjust added to each element.
1100 for (unsigned i = 0; i < sizeof(test_data); ++i) {
1101 if (test_data[i] != i + kTestDataAdjust) {
1102 unittest_printf("test_prep_and_segv: bad data on resumption, test_data[%u] = 0x%x\n", i,
1103 test_data[i]);